Weekend round-up: music for a broken budget
Wallet feeling a little light after all that hard partying in Indio? Never fear Wyldies, we are rounding up the best bet music events all under $10 this weekend around the bay including:
Thursday:
In San Francisco, The Knockout has your indie bang for just a few bucks with The Harderships, Mamatus, and a very special surprise guest. 9:30PM $6.
Friday:
Tik Tik Fly, The Downer Party* and The Tunnel converge on Oakland's The Uptown for a night of folk/goth/punk/easy listening /pop rock chaos. Doors at 9PM, No cover. At the same time just a few miles away former lyricist for Da Lench Mob and hip-hop royalty in his own right, Del the Funky Homosapien will be blowing the doors off The Shattuck Downlow in Berkeley for a one night only FREE LIVE PERFORMANCE rumored to include a full band; Doors at 9PM, get there early if you plan on getting in.
While all of that is going down in the East Bay, over in SF it's a Schizophrenic extravaganza with thrash/pop/country vaudeville acts Disasteroid, The Here and Fondue at El Rio. $8 Doors at 9pm.

Local rockers Catholic Radio and The Better Maker are taking over the Make-Out Room in San Francisco for a night of driving indie pop rock/punk fun. $7 Doors at 7. Be sure to check out downloads from the recently released debut album from Catholic Radio here, before the show.
Sunday:
Head on over to legendary 924 Gilman in Berkeley, and get ready to Skank with Columbian Ska/Punk/Reggae act Skampida. If it's been years, or if you have never been at all to the Bay Area's most iconic venue now is the time. The show starts early 4PM, $8 cover.
